Abingdon, Va. -- Teaching middle school is no easy task. But a Tri-Cities region school is so good at it - it's earned national recognition.
E.B. Stanley Middle School in Abingdon, Va. was named a "School to Watch" for excellence in middle school education.
Community leaders met at the school this morning to celebrate the honor. Only sixteen middle schools in Virginia have ever received this award since it began in 2003.
An assessment team visited the school and determined it was worthy of the national destination.
The "Schools to Watch" recognition is a self-nominated process, and schools in 18 around the country apply.
The award lasts for three years, and by then, it's time for schools to re-apply, as they continue working toward excellence.
